1. Sleep Wake Disorder
This condition entails an inequality between your body's biological rhythm and the outside setting, frequently causing difficulties in preserving a routine sleep timetable. A rest specialist can aid you straighten your body clock via light treatment, behavior adjustments, and leisure strategies.
2. Narcolepsy Treatment
Narcolepsy is a neurological problem that causes excessive daytime drowsiness and unexpected muscle mass weakness (cataplexy). A sleep specialist jobs very closely with a rest medication doctor to create an administration strategy, which may include behavioral techniques and drug changes.
3. Parasomnia Treatment
Parasomnias are disruptive sleep behaviors, such as sleepwalking, problems, or rest talking. While these behaviors can be distressing, they are treatable. A rest therapist frequently employs strategies to determine triggers and decrease episodes, particularly with rest talking treatment or other targeted therapies.
4. Hypersomnia Treatment
Hypersomnia involves extreme drowsiness throughout the day, even after a complete night's remainder. A sleep specialist assesses possible underlying reasons, such as way of life elements, clinical problems, or emotional tension, and establishes strategies to take care of excessive drowsiness.
5. Insomnia
Among the most typical rest problems, sleeplessness is defined by problem falling or remaining asleep. CBT-I, supplied by an sleeplessness physician or rest therapist, is one of one of the most reliable treatments offered.

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y for Insomnia (CBT-I)
CBT-I is a keystone of rest treatment. It concentrates on identifying and changing believed patterns and habits that disrupt sleep. For example, you could:
- Develop a regular going to bed regimen.
- Discover leisure methods to handle pre-sleep stress and anxiety.
- Reframe unfavorable thoughts regarding sleep.

Self-Help Tips to Complement Sleep Therapy
While dealing with a sleep therapist, you can take on these self-help methods to enhance your sleep wellness:
- Stick to a Sleep Schedule: Go to bed and awaken at the same time everyday, even on weekend breaks.
- Produce a Sleep-Friendly Environment: Keep your bedroom cool, dark, and silent.
- Exercise Relaxation Techniques: Deep breathing, meditation, or dynamic muscle mass leisure can assist you unwind prior to bed.
- Monitor Your Sleep Habits: Keep a journal to track your rest patterns and determine triggers.
- Restriction Stimulants: Avoid caffeine and pure nicotine in the hours leading up to bedtime.
